Why Binary Is Used by the Most Electronic Machines?
Binary
is one of the most popular numbering system used by most of the computer
systems and electronic devices. Most of the devices use this to make it work
faster. There are other numbering systems like decimal, octal, hexadecimal also
available but most technical people prefer binary. Here, we give you different
reasons, why this numbering system is used by most electronic machines?
1)
It consists of just two numbers zeros and ones
Yes,
you have read it correctly. The binary numbers consist of just two numbers. The
first is zero and the second is one. Though using just two numbers make binary
lengthy but it is convenient for the computer or electronic systems to read
these numbers.
This is
one of the simplest reasons why most tech people are using binary numbers for
their electronic products.

4)
Logic circuits creation gets easy
The
logic circuits are physical devices that implement Boolean expressions. These
Boolean expressions use binary values heavily. These login circuits include
multiplexers, registers, ALUS, and many other devices. In the tables, 1 means
the gate is open and 0 means the gate is closed. The truth table has AND, NAND, OR, NOR, XOR, XNOR. Most of the
routers and other devices are using these logic circuits. Now a day, it is
quite simple and obvious to use circuits for a electronic device’s back-end.
